The University of Texas at Austin and a former academic adviser jointly agreed to end litigation over harassment in the workplace.
The parties will bear their own fees and costs, according to a joint dismissal Thursday that provided no other details about the agreement.
Malia LiVolsi, who worked in the Butler School of Music, said the school failed to adequately handle her complaints after John Turci-Escobar, assistant dean for undergraduate studies in the College of Fine Arts, sent her repeated text messages “unrelated to her job” in April 2022.
